The use of the star shape was inspired by the name 'ful-vue' and also the name of the founder of the studio 'Sol' which means sun in Spanish. Not wanting to be constrained by one or two colours, as most brands are. The Ful-vue star has been created by superimposing three triangles. Each triangle features a spectrum of colours starting with the primary colours, secondary colours and tertiary colours. When the three triangles are overlapped they feature a full spectrum of colours.
